Tragic Lagos Accident Claims Woman's Life, Injures Six Others
A devastating road accident at New Castle Bus Stop along the Oworonsoki-Apapa Expressway in Lagos has resulted in the death of a female passenger and left six others with severe injuries. The Lagos State Traffic Management Authority confirmed the tragic incident occurred over the weekend.
Details of the Fatal Collision
According to Adebayo Taofiq, spokesperson for the Lagos State Traffic Management Authority, the accident involved a Volkswagen commercial bus with registration number LSD 654 XY. The vehicle reportedly veered off course and violently collided with a roadside culvert along the expressway corridor.
The impact of the crash was so forceful that it ejected a female passenger from the bus onto the expressway roadway. Six other occupants of the commercial bus, including the driver, sustained serious injuries with multiple fractures reported among the victims.
Tragic Turn of Events
In a heartbreaking sequence of events, an oncoming articulated trailer approaching the accident scene was unable to avoid the sudden occurrence. The large vehicle consequently ran over the passenger who had fallen onto the roadway, resulting in her immediate death at the scene.
"Reports revealed that a Volkswagen commercial bus veered off course and violently rammed into a roadside culvert along the corridor," stated Taofiq in an official statement released on Sunday, March 8.
Emergency Response and Aftermath
Personnel from the Lagos State Ambulance Service promptly responded to the scene and evacuated the injured victims to a nearby hospital for urgent medical treatment. The six survivors are receiving care for their various injuries, which include multiple fractures sustained during the violent collision.
Officials from the Lagos State Environmental Health Monitoring Unit were dispatched to remove the remains of the deceased woman from the accident scene. The incident has raised concerns about road safety along the busy Oworonsoki-Apapa Expressway corridor, particularly at the New Castle Bus Stop area in Gbagada.
